Abstract

We show that for all integers m ≤ 4 there exists a 2m × 2m × m latin cuboid that cannot be completed to a 2m×2m×2m latin cube. We also show that for all even m >2 there exists a (2m-1) × (2m-1) × (m-1) latin cuboid that cannot be extended to any (2m-1) × (2m-1) × m latin cuboid.
